免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

apple 开发语言

Apple开发语言,即苹果公司推出的编程语言,目前主要包括Swift和Objective-C两种。

Swift是苹果公司于2014年推出的一种编程语言,它是开放源代码的、较新的多范式编程语言,适用于iOS、macOS、watchOS和tvOS等苹果操作系统。Swift的设计目标是提供比Objective-C更加安全和易于阅读和维护的语言,同时也尽力优化了性能,以减少运行速度和开发时间。Swift拥有更加现代化、便于于人类理解的语法,使得开发者更容易进行代码编写和调试。Swift还采用了ARC(Automatic Reference Counting)进行内存管理,自动为程序分配内存空间,非常方便。

Objective-C是一种基于C语言的面向对象的编程语言,是苹果公司最早推广的语言之一,已经使用了20多年。Objective-C被广泛地应用于苹果公司的操作系统(OS X和iOS)以及一些流行的开源框架(如Cocoa和Cocoa Touch)中。Objective-C经常被用于应用程序和软件库的开发,包括游戏、移动应用程序和桌面应用程序等。Objective-C语言支持动态绑定和消息传递,能够在运行时进行编程。

Swift和Objective-C都支持使用Xcode进行编写和调试。

总之,随着苹果公司在移动设备市场的强势崛起,逐步壮大的苹果开发者社区也迅速成长。Swift和Objective-C,无论是在语法、运行效率还是开发效率上,都是非常有优势的开发语言,在各自的开发场景中都有其得天独厚的比较优势。如果你想要进军苹果开发领域,那么学习一下Swift和Objective-C将是一个不错的选择。


相关知识:
如何利用python开发手机app
随着移动互联网的快速发展,移动应用程序成为了人们日常生活不可或缺的一部分。而Python语言作为一种功能强大的编程语言,也可以用来开发移动应用程序。本文将介绍如何利用Python开发手机App的原理和详细步骤。一、Python开发移动App的原理Pytho
2024-01-10
app开发遵义
App开发是指通过开发软件应用程序,使其能够在移动设备上运行,为用户提供各种功能和服务。在本文中,我将详细介绍App开发的原理和流程。一、App开发的原理1. 平台选择:首先要确定开发的目标平台,例如iOS、Android或者是多平台兼容的Hybrid A
2023-06-29
app开发报价方案专题
随着智能手机的普及,移动应用市场也日渐繁荣。越来越多的企业开始考虑开发一款移动应用,以进一步拓展业务和提升品牌声誉。这时候,一个问题始终困扰着他们:开发一款移动应用需要多少费用?本文将从理论和实践的角度,详细介绍移动应用开发的报价方案。一、理论方面1.开发
2023-06-29
app 应用开发语言
应用程序开发语言是应用程序员使用的编程语言,可用于开发应用程序、游戏,以及进行系统编程和其他编程任务。在移动应用开发领域,Android应用程序开发通常使用Java,并使用Android SDK提供的类来完成工作。而在iOS应用程序开发领域,使用Objec
2023-05-06
all第二届工业app开发与应用
第二届工业APP开发与应用会议是一场面向工业公司及开发者的盛会,旨在推动工业APP的发展与应用,探索工业互联网、智能制造等新兴技术的创新应用。该会议涉及的主题涵盖了工业互联网、智能制造、物联网、大数据、人工智能等领域,重点关注工业APP的开发与应用,以及如
2023-05-06
在线网址生成app推荐一门APP在线开发平台工具
目前市场上有多个提供在线网址生成app服务的平台,例如一门APP开发平台、edabao.net易打包等。这些平台通常提供云编译、云打包、云更新等功能,方便用户管理和维护自己的APP应用。同时,这些平台也提供丰富的API、模块、组件等资源,帮助用户实现更多的功能和效果。在线网址生成app是一种适合初级开发者或有简单需求的用户使用的技术方案 。
2023-03-21